Financial Opportunity Centers


Financial Opportunity Centers are career and personal financial service centers that focus on increasing the financial bottom line for low-to-moderate income individuals. LISC’s innovative approach of integrated employment services coupled with financial education and coaching services offers low-income families the support they need to grow their assets and build toward a more prosperous future.
   

FOCs provide families with services across three areas: 

  • Employment placement and career improvement
  • Financial education and coaching 
  • Public benefits access

These core services are integrated together and offer a “one stop shop” for building income and wealth. The model for these centers was developed by the Annie E. Casey Foundation.

Since launching in Chicago in 2005, LISC's network has expanded to over 60 FOCs in 14 regions. Currently, LISC Milwaukee has two centers hosted by Riverworks Economic Development Corporation serving residents in the Harambee neighborhood; and Journey House, serving South Side residents in Clarke Square.
